ASKING FOR HELP

Consultants and human resource practitioners have told CCL that the organizations with which they work are encountering issues of social identity conflict more and more frequently. These practitioners want to know if there are any interventions they can use. Leaders can consider the strategies outlined in this article in combination with a thorough assessment of their specific situations, including their own strengths and weaknesses and the characteristics and needs of the groups with which they are dealing. But each leader should always keep in mind the context of his or her organization's values, rules, structures, cultures, and goals.
